Job Description

Principal/Senior Medical Editor quality-checking and leading medical writing deliverables for Syneos Health’s life-sciences services. Ensuring regulatory compliance, editorial accuracy, and on-time project delivery.

Responsibilities:

  • Maintain familiarity with FDA, EU, and other relevant guidelines and industry standards to ensure documents meet sponsor and regulatory requirements
  • Represent the editorial group in medical writing, study teams, and cross-departmental project teams
  • Monitor timelines and budgets for assigned projects and escalate deliverable risks
  • Provide technical support and expertise
  • Conduct training and mentor medical editing staff
  • Advise medical writers, medical editors, and study teams on quality review, compilation, and editorial standards
  • Train members of the global medical writing team
  • Lead deliverables for complex and/or large medical writing projects
  • Schedule and lead internal project-specific team meetings
  • Organize project requirements and ensure information is distributed to and implemented by the editorial team
  • Serve as a medical writing team member for projects with medical writing deliverables
  • Provide feedback to the lead medical writer on editorial progress
  • Copyedit assigned documents using grammar, punctuation, spelling, style, AMA Manual of Style, custom style guidelines, checklists, and best practices
  • Perform quality review of assigned documents for accuracy
  • Contribute to process improvement tools and internal policies and procedures
  • Manage assigned projects according to medical writing SOPs and client standards, on time and on budget
  • Compile medical writing deliverables as needed
